Sinharaja Rainforest

Sinharaja Forest Reserve is Sri Lanka's last viable area of primary tropical rainforest and a UNESCO World Heritage Site. This biodiversity hotspot is home to an incredible array of endemic species found nowhere else on Earth.

Highlights

  • Guided jungle treks through pristine rainforest
  • Spot endemic birds including Sri Lanka Blue Magpie
  • See rare purple-faced langurs and other endemic mammals
  • Experience mixed-species bird flocks
  • Visit waterfalls and natural pools

Best Time to Visit

December to April for drier conditions

Duration

Half to full day trek

Tips

Hire a local guide mandatory. Wear leech socks and rain gear. Bring binoculars for bird watching. Stay nearby to start early.
